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
38 871320 48235
03 26086119011
03 26086119011
68431491799 05487 86265569 287234
All about undefined
Interested in learning more?
03 26086119011
68431491799 05487 86265569 287234
See more
0994 54607661 54372
47060764 9163 628784
See more
942 5520730453 6372870199
719833 4128952 9746384 851157
See more